Bust of Vespasian from the Copenhagen Ny Carlsberg Glyptotek
To celebrate 2000 years since the birth of the Emperor Vespasian or, if you prefer, Titus Flavius Vespasianus, Rome is holding a unique exhibition at the Colosseum dedicated entirely to the emperor and the Flavian dynasty he founded.
Unlike previous exhibitions which were confined to the inner halls of the Colosseum, the exhibition ‘Divus Vespasianus – Il Bimillenario dei Flavi’ (The God Vespasian – the Bi-millenium of the Flavians) quite literally leads the visitor on a pilgrimage to the remaining monumental locations that can be attributed to the three Emperors of the dynasty: Vespasian (69-79AD), Titus (79-81AD) and Domitian (81-96AD).
One can explore the urban development and the monumental contributions of the Flavians: the arches of Titus and Domitian, the Horrea Vespasiani, the temple of Divus Vespasianus, the Equus Domitiani and much more, including the Colosseum itself.
The exhibition runs from 27 March 2009 until 10 January 2010.
